Solving Generalized Optimization Problems Subject to SMT Constraints
In a classical constrained optimization problem, the logical relationship among the constraints is normally the logical conjunction. However, in many real applications, the relationship among the constraints might be more complex. This paper investigates a generalized class of optimization problems...
Saved in:
Published in | Frontiers in Algorithmics and Algorithmic Aspects in Information and Management Vol. 7285; pp. 247 - 258 |
---|---|
Main Authors | , , |
Format | Book Chapter |
Language | English |
Published |
Germany
Springer Berlin / Heidelberg
2012
Springer Berlin Heidelberg |
Series | Lecture Notes in Computer Science |
Online Access | Get full text |
ISBN | 9783642296994 3642296998 |
ISSN | 0302-9743 1611-3349 |
DOI | 10.1007/978-3-642-29700-7_23 |
Cover
Loading…
Abstract | In a classical constrained optimization problem, the logical relationship among the constraints is normally the logical conjunction. However, in many real applications, the relationship among the constraints might be more complex. This paper investigates a generalized class of optimization problems whose constraints are connected by various kinds of logical operators in addition to conjunction. Such optimization problems have been rarely studied in literature in contrast to the classical ones. A framework which integrates classical optimization procedures into the DPLL(T) architecture for solving Satisfiability Modulo Theories (SMT) problems is proposed. Two novel techniques for improving the solving efficiency w.r.t. linear arithmetic theory are also presented. Experiments show that the proposed techniques are quite effective. |
---|---|
AbstractList | In a classical constrained optimization problem, the logical relationship among the constraints is normally the logical conjunction. However, in many real applications, the relationship among the constraints might be more complex. This paper investigates a generalized class of optimization problems whose constraints are connected by various kinds of logical operators in addition to conjunction. Such optimization problems have been rarely studied in literature in contrast to the classical ones. A framework which integrates classical optimization procedures into the DPLL(T) architecture for solving Satisfiability Modulo Theories (SMT) problems is proposed. Two novel techniques for improving the solving efficiency w.r.t. linear arithmetic theory are also presented. Experiments show that the proposed techniques are quite effective. |
Author | Yan, Jun Zhang, Jian Ma, Feifei |
Author_xml | – sequence: 1 givenname: Feifei surname: Ma fullname: Ma, Feifei email: maff@ios.ac.cn organization: Institute of Software, Chinese Academy of Sciences, China – sequence: 2 givenname: Jun surname: Yan fullname: Yan, Jun email: junyan@acm.org organization: Institute of Software, Chinese Academy of Sciences, China – sequence: 3 givenname: Jian surname: Zhang fullname: Zhang, Jian email: jian_zhangg@acm.org organization: State Key Laboratory of Computer Science, China |
BookMark | eNpNkMFOwzAQRA0URCn9Aw75AcOu7drxERUoSKAitZyt2HEhJY1DnHLo1-MWDuxlpZmd1ehdkEETGk_IFcI1AqgbrXLKqRSMMq0AqDKMH5FxknkSD5o6JkOUiJRzoU_-eVJrMSBD4MCoVoKfkaHS6ShZcE7GMa4hjZQSIR-Su0Wov6vmPZv5xndFXe18mc3bvtpUu6KvQpO9dsHWfhOzxdauveuzPmSLl2U2DU3su6Jq-nhJTldFHf34b4_I28P9cvpIn-ezp-ntM21xknO68lKWYL11yBjmJc8xd96BKhk6LG3SHEN0AixY55Vk3LoJc1ZIZEoIPiLs929su9TZd8aG8BkNgtljM4mB4SZRMAdEZo8thcRvqO3C19bH3vh9yvkmta_dR9H2vouGg4JcSYM6pSea_wDlwWyv |
ContentType | Book Chapter |
Copyright | Springer-Verlag Berlin Heidelberg 2012 |
Copyright_xml | – notice: Springer-Verlag Berlin Heidelberg 2012 |
DBID | FFUUA |
DEWEY | 005.1 |
DOI | 10.1007/978-3-642-29700-7_23 |
DatabaseName | ProQuest Ebook Central - Book Chapters - Demo use only |
DatabaseTitleList | |
DeliveryMethod | fulltext_linktorsrc |
Discipline | Computer Science |
EISBN | 9783642297007 3642297005 |
EISSN | 1611-3349 |
Editor | Lu, Pinyan Su, Kaile Snoeyink, Jack Wang, Lusheng |
Editor_xml | – sequence: 1 fullname: Lu, Pinyan – sequence: 2 fullname: Su, Kaile – sequence: 3 fullname: Wang, Lusheng – sequence: 4 fullname: Snoeyink, Jack |
EndPage | 258 |
ExternalDocumentID | EBC3070876_192_259 |
GroupedDBID | 089 0D6 0DA 2HV 38. A4J AABBV AAFYB AAPKO ABBVZ ABFCL ABFCV ABMNI ADWNV AEDXK AEJLV AEKFX AETDV AEZAY AFSBW AIJHZ AIMOO ALMA_UNASSIGNED_HOLDINGS AZZ BBABE CZZ FFUUA I4C IEZ IX. MA. PH7 PI1 SBO TGCOT TPJZQ TSXQS Z81 Z83 Z88 -DT -GH -~X 1SB 29L 2HA 5QI 875 AASHB ACGFS ADCXD AEFIE EJD F5P FEDTE HVGLF LAS LDH P2P RIG RNI RSU SVGTG VI1 ~02 |
ID | FETCH-LOGICAL-p1583-fe66d0bebc12218d3818cec07d21c1db218c211c40b0bce7623bc52cb46127443 |
ISBN | 9783642296994 3642296998 |
ISSN | 0302-9743 |
IngestDate | Tue Jul 29 20:14:30 EDT 2025 Thu May 29 16:08:01 EDT 2025 |
IsPeerReviewed | false |
IsScholarly | false |
LCCallNum | QA76.9.A43 |
Language | English |
LinkModel | OpenURL |
MergedId | FETCHMERGED-LOGICAL-p1583-fe66d0bebc12218d3818cec07d21c1db218c211c40b0bce7623bc52cb46127443 |
OCLC | 793342290 |
PQID | EBC3070876_192_259 |
PageCount | 12 |
ParticipantIDs | springer_books_10_1007_978_3_642_29700_7_23 proquest_ebookcentralchapters_3070876_192_259 |
PublicationCentury | 2000 |
PublicationDate | 2012 |
PublicationDateYYYYMMDD | 2012-01-01 |
PublicationDate_xml | – year: 2012 text: 2012 |
PublicationDecade | 2010 |
PublicationPlace | Germany |
PublicationPlace_xml | – name: Germany – name: Berlin, Heidelberg |
PublicationSeriesTitle | Lecture Notes in Computer Science |
PublicationSubtitle | Joint International Conference, FAW-AAIM 2012, Beijing, China, May 14-16, 2012, Proceedings |
PublicationTitle | Frontiers in Algorithmics and Algorithmic Aspects in Information and Management |
PublicationYear | 2012 |
Publisher | Springer Berlin / Heidelberg Springer Berlin Heidelberg |
Publisher_xml | – name: Springer Berlin / Heidelberg – name: Springer Berlin Heidelberg |
RelatedPersons | Kleinberg, Jon M. Mattern, Friedemann Nierstrasz, Oscar Steffen, Bernhard Kittler, Josef Vardi, Moshe Y. Weikum, Gerhard Sudan, Madhu Naor, Moni Mitchell, John C. Terzopoulos, Demetri Pandu Rangan, C. Kanade, Takeo Hutchison, David Tygar, Doug |
RelatedPersons_xml | – sequence: 1 givenname: David surname: Hutchison fullname: Hutchison, David organization: Lancaster University, Lancaster, UK – sequence: 2 givenname: Takeo surname: Kanade fullname: Kanade, Takeo organization: Carnegie Mellon University, Pittsburgh, USA – sequence: 3 givenname: Josef surname: Kittler fullname: Kittler, Josef organization: University of Surrey, Guildford, UK – sequence: 4 givenname: Jon M. surname: Kleinberg fullname: Kleinberg, Jon M. organization: Cornell University, Ithaca, USA – sequence: 5 givenname: Friedemann surname: Mattern fullname: Mattern, Friedemann organization: ETH Zurich, Zurich, Switzerland – sequence: 6 givenname: John C. surname: Mitchell fullname: Mitchell, John C. organization: Stanford University, Stanford, USA – sequence: 7 givenname: Moni surname: Naor fullname: Naor, Moni organization: Weizmann Institute of Science, Rehovot, Israel – sequence: 8 givenname: Oscar surname: Nierstrasz fullname: Nierstrasz, Oscar organization: University of Bern, Bern, Switzerland – sequence: 9 givenname: C. surname: Pandu Rangan fullname: Pandu Rangan, C. organization: Indian Institute of Technology, Madras, India – sequence: 10 givenname: Bernhard surname: Steffen fullname: Steffen, Bernhard organization: University of Dortmund, Dortmund, Germany – sequence: 11 givenname: Madhu surname: Sudan fullname: Sudan, Madhu organization: Massachusetts Institute of Technology, USA – sequence: 12 givenname: Demetri surname: Terzopoulos fullname: Terzopoulos, Demetri organization: University of California, Los Angeles, USA – sequence: 13 givenname: Doug surname: Tygar fullname: Tygar, Doug organization: University of California, Berkeley, USA – sequence: 14 givenname: Moshe Y. surname: Vardi fullname: Vardi, Moshe Y. organization: Rice University, Houston, USA – sequence: 15 givenname: Gerhard surname: Weikum fullname: Weikum, Gerhard organization: Max-Planck Institute of Computer Science, Saarbrücken, Germany |
SSID | ssj0000666108 ssj0002792 |
Score | 1.3996637 |
Snippet | In a classical constrained optimization problem, the logical relationship among the constraints is normally the logical conjunction. However, in many real... |
SourceID | springer proquest |
SourceType | Publisher |
StartPage | 247 |
Title | Solving Generalized Optimization Problems Subject to SMT Constraints |
URI | http://ebookcentral.proquest.com/lib/SITE_ID/reader.action?docID=3070876&ppg=259 http://link.springer.com/10.1007/978-3-642-29700-7_23 |
Volume | 7285 |
hasFullText | 1 |
inHoldings | 1 |
isFullTextHit | |
isPrint | |
link | http://utb.summon.serialssolutions.com/2.0.0/link/0/eLvHCXMwnV07b9swECYcdyk69I2mL3DoZrAQH5KsoUPRJgiMOB3qFNkIkaJaA4kdxMqSv9E_3Ds-ZMUNCqSLYBCCLN1HHI_H-74j5IMtasmNzZirWsuUqg0zuXHM1UXd5E2VW4EE5_lJcXSqZmf52Wj0e1C1dN2Zj_bmTl7J_6AKY4ArsmTvgWz_UBiA34AvXAFhuO4Ev7fTrKHvEEoPYCNrn7I4_7mGbf6viyS6PBgACC59zcYSE4A9WzGWWOxWv8x9NHnolq1b9i6hjgyOfib1eeZZP70S3ffcpyiinPXyBgLab-CWLiLfE5kJ2MFmgy4Lc0AY_H6fL3znUN-vIkhLeQO6zafjeMZxsu586dgktaFIXmmYtvD1H8O0RUpbTv6h6uUZJkqIqqhCI-RE9AInDtug4Bdd8NsFqjHKoH6afHGQ8ozLuggK8X-tGMMikQKpSlWZZazUQu6RvXKqxuTB54PZ8Y8-cYcbPp5tJelRgTEcVYW3QgJReutpkHjafsWAvHnXX97a5uyczPuAZ_GEPEISDEV2Ctj6KRm51TPyONmeRts_J18j3nSANx3iTRPeNOJNuzUFvOkA7xfk9PBg8eWIxcYc7JLnU8laVxRNZpyxXECI2GDUZ53NykZwyxsDY1ZwblVmMmMdrLfS2FxYoyCeLpWSL8l4tV65V4Ry3jrZSCuclcrk08rYWllheFuKVuVin7BkEe3LB2LNsg3fv9G4ZsGKrmGnomErv08myWwab9_opMsN9tZSg721t7dGe7--191vyMPtTH5Lxt3VtXsHIWln3sdJ8gewooYy |
linkProvider | Library Specific Holdings |
openUrl | ctx_ver=Z39.88-2004&ctx_enc=info%3Aofi%2Fenc%3AUTF-8&rfr_id=info%3Asid%2Fsummon.serialssolutions.com&rft_val_fmt=info%3Aofi%2Ffmt%3Akev%3Amtx%3Abook&rft.genre=bookitem&rft.title=Frontiers+in+Algorithmics+and+Algorithmic+Aspects+in+Information+and+Management&rft.au=Ma%2C+Feifei&rft.au=Yan%2C+Jun&rft.au=Zhang%2C+Jian&rft.atitle=Solving+Generalized+Optimization+Problems+Subject+to+SMT+Constraints&rft.series=Lecture+Notes+in+Computer+Science&rft.date=2012-01-01&rft.pub=Springer+Berlin+Heidelberg&rft.isbn=9783642296994&rft.issn=0302-9743&rft.eissn=1611-3349&rft.spage=247&rft.epage=258&rft_id=info:doi/10.1007%2F978-3-642-29700-7_23 |
thumbnail_s | http://utb.summon.serialssolutions.com/2.0.0/image/custom?url=https%3A%2F%2Febookcentral.proquest.com%2Fcovers%2F3070876-l.jpg |